Is pressure a contact or non-contact force?
Pressure is a contact force because it arises due to the interaction between two objects that are in contact with each other. It is the force applied perpendicular to the surface of an object due to the external load or the weight of the object itself.

How does post consumer regrind compare with PLA?
Post consumer regrind is Plastic (mainly HDPE, LDPE and PET) that has been cleaned and reground into pellet or flake form to make a new plastic object (packaging is a big one). So, in short post consumer regrind or PCR is recycled plastic.
PLA is short or Poly lactic acid and is one of many bioplastics. This one is specific is made from corn starch. Not sure but I think Natureworks is the main supplier.
The difference is PCR is more stable and has many more uses because the material is just recycled plastic. PLA, because it is made from natural substances, breaks down, melts and losses its rigidity a lot faster and is typically used for one time use. PLA is best used for products that will not have to endure long shelf life or hold volatile products.
There are many advancements being made to bioplastics/biopolymers that will improve its rigidity, strength and shelf-life. It's almost hard to keep up! PLA is only one of many biopolymers. They can be made from starches such as potato, pea and corn as well as sugar. But I'm sure there's many more in development!

What objects has the element californium in them?
Some applications of californium:
- neutron source as Cf-Be source
- neutron source for neutron activation analysis (portable installations)
- neutron radiography
- irradiation for some cancers treatment
- nuclear fuel rod scanning
- neutron source to detect water, petroleum, metals, methane

What is the difference between the performance values obtained from load test and sc and oc tests?
Load test measures the system's performance under typical conditions, simulating real-world scenarios with normal user activity. On the other hand, short-circuit (SC) and open-circuit (OC) tests in electronics are used to determine the behavior of a circuit under fault conditions such as a direct short or an open connection, rather than normal operating conditions. In essence, load tests assess normal performance, while SC and OC tests evaluate behavior during abnormal scenarios.

What are the things made from krypton?
Krypton is a noble gas; and as such has extremely few chemical reactions, and no stable chemical compounds. Like neon and argon, its chemical cousins, it fluoresces when electricity is applied; so it does see some use in specialty lighting (similar to neon signs).
One key use, important to the semiconductor industry, is as a powerful ultraviolet laser. Molecules of krypton temporarily bond with fluorine, one of the most chemically active elements, and then release their energy in the wavelengths well beyond visible light. A higher wavelength means both more energy and a thinner, more precise laser; this combination allows computer chip manufacturers to pack ever more transistors (into the tens of billions) onto a single chip.
It's also used in the aerospace industry; certain spark gap assemblies have a tiny amount of the gas, which improves their efficiency. And one isotope of krypton has found use in the medical field: when inhaled, krypton-83 shows up in breathing passages in an MRI, allowing certain medical issues to be detected. It has a similar use in CT scans, where it is often mixed with its heavier cousin xenon.

Why did Rutherford use a vacuum?
Rutherford used a vacuum in his experiment to eliminate any air molecules that could interfere with the path of the alpha particles. This allowed him to study how the alpha particles interacted with the gold foil and draw conclusions about the structure of the atom.

Why are some thing shiny and others not?
The shininess of an object depends on its surface texture and composition. Shiny objects have smooth surfaces that reflect light uniformly, while dull objects have rough surfaces that scatter light in different directions, making them appear less shiny. Materials like metals or glass are generally shiny due to their smooth surface properties, while materials like fabrics or paper are dull because of their rough texture.

What bomb had the greatest damage on earth?
The most destructive bomb in history was the Tsar Bomba, a hydrogen bomb tested by the Soviet Union in 1961. It had an explosive power of 50 megatons, making it the most powerful nuclear weapon ever detonated. Why can your microwave oven have a metal shelf?
A microwave oven may include a metal component, like a shelf, if it is of the manufacturer's design. A manufacturer can properly design and place a metal component in a microwave oven by ensuring that it is not, and cannot become, a microwave antenna.
If a metal component is designed by the manufacturer, specifically for its ovens, it is safe to use (per the instructions). Utensils, aluminum foil, gilding, and other metal objects act as antennae causing arcing and possible fires, and may cause damage to the oven.

What is the difference between physical structure and logical structure of a disk?
Physical structure refers to the actual layout of data on the disk, including sectors, tracks, and cylinders. Logical structure refers to how the operating system organizes and accesses data on the disk, such as partitions, file systems, and directories.

What are the main source of carbon dioxide?
The main sources of carbon dioxide are burning fossil fuels (such as coal, oil, and natural gas), deforestation, and industrial processes like cement production. These activities release carbon dioxide into the atmosphere, contributing to the greenhouse effect and climate change.
